Islamic Finance: Transactions and Disputes

The last Wednesday Seminar of the year was delivered by Dr. Walid Hegazy, Founder and Managing Partner of Hegazy & Associates (in association with Crowell & Moring) on “Islamic Finance: Transactions and Disputes”. The lecturer approached Islamic Finance as a globally growing phenomenon and analyzed its key foundations, mainly key Shari’a concepts and principles. The practical implications of Islamic legal and economic principles were also thoroughly discussed.

Attendees were a mixture of economists and lawyers who interacted all together in a lively fashion.
